Rainy day activities for preschoolers.

Rainy-day activities need to absorb energy without turning the room upside down. These are small, resettable ideas that work when everyone is stuck inside.

Quick pick: Rotate between one movement idea, one building idea, and one quiet idea.

Cardboard Car Ramp

quick building, toy car play, cause and effect

3-5 years 2 min low mess low help
Needcardboard, books, toy cars
  1. Stack books.
  2. Lay cardboard on top.
  3. Pick a car.
  4. Roll and change the ramp.

Parent check: Keep the ramp low and away from stairs.

Blanket River

pretend play, indoor movement, bridge building

3-6 years 2 min low mess medium help
Needblanket, blocks
  1. Lay a blanket.
  2. Build a bridge.
  3. Cross the river.
  4. Move the bridge.

Parent check: No running on blankets.
